Detailed information
Overview
| Name | dprA | Type | Machinery gene |
| Locus tag | KBU60_RS15340 | Genome accession | NZ_CP073068 |
| Coordinates | 3278580..3279692 (-) | Length | 370 a.a. |
| NCBI ID | WP_140123174.1 | Uniprot ID | - |
| Organism | Vibrio parahaemolyticus strain FB-11 | ||
| Function | ssDNA binding; loading RecA onto ssDNA (predicted from homology) DNA processing |
